The Hon Matthew Mason-Cox MLC to Deputy Premier, Minister for Transport
and Minister for Finance:
Minister, I want to ask you a series of questions on the Tcard. The budget
papers reveal that about $64 million has been spent by the State Government
on the Tcard project to date. What specifically has this money been spent on?
Answer:
I am advised that, as at 30 June 2007, the total cost incurred on the Tcard
project is $65.64 million. The capital component of this expenditure to 30 June
2007 was $60.8 million against the capital budget estimate of $64 million.
I am advised that this consists of costs associated with the design,
implementation and project management of the Tcard system, the installation
of infrastructure as part of an early works program, interest costs and some
minor capital payments. However, no contract milestones have been reached
that trigger payment to Integrated Transit Solutions Limited.

The Hon Matthew Mason-Cox to the Deputy Premier, Minister for Transport
and Minister for Finance:
"Why did you announce widespread trials of the Tcard project before the last
State election when you must have known that the project was not meeting
the milestones you had already announced?
Answer:
I was advised by the Public Transport Ticketing Corporation (PTTC) in August
2006 that Tcard trials involving commuters on selected bus services in
Sydney's Inner West were expected to take place in October 2006. However,
problems with the Tcard system were subsequently discovered.
In order to avoid disruption to the travelling public, the commencement of the
trials was delayed.

The Hon Matthew Mason-Cox to the Deputy Premier, Minister for Transport
and Minister for Finance:
"When does the Government expect network-wide trials of the Tcard to
proceed?"
"So where are we up to now?"
Answer:
I have been advised by the Public Transport Ticketing Corporation (PTTC)
that a limited Bus Field Trial has been in operation since May 2007 with staff
from various transport agencies. On 8 October 2007, volunteers from the
general public were re-contacted to assess their willingness to continue with
the trial, which is expected to commence before the end of the year. A
number of third-party distribution outlets have also been commissioned.
